NAME
mq_notify -- notify process that a message is available (REALTIME) LIBRARY
POSIX Real-time Library (librt, -lrt) SYNOPSIS
#include <mqueue.h> int mq_notify(mqd_t mqdes, const struct sigevent *notification); DESCRIPTION
If the argument notification is not NULL, this system call will register the calling process to be notified of message arrival at an empty message queue associated with the specified message queue descriptor, mqdes. The notification specified by the notification argument will be sent to the process when the message queue transitions from empty to non-empty. At any time, only one process may be registered for notifi- cation by a message queue. If the calling process or any other process has already registered for notification of message arrival at the specified message queue, subsequent attempts to register for that message queue will fail. The notification argument points to a sigevent structure that defines how the calling process will be notified. If notification->sigev_notify is SIGEV_NONE, then no signal will be posted, but the error status and the return status for the operation will be set appropriately. If notification->sigev_notify is SIGEV_SIGNAL, then the signal specified in notification->sigev_signo will be sent to the process. The signal will be queued to the process and the value specified in notification->sigev_value will be the si_value component of the generated signal. If notification is NULL and the process is currently registered for notification by the specified message queue, the existing registration will be removed. When the notification is sent to the registered process, its registration is removed. The message queue then is available for registration. If a process has registered for notification of message arrival at a message queue and some thread is blocked in mq_receive() waiting to receive a message when a message arrives at the queue, the arriving message will satisfy the appropriate mq_receive(). The resulting behav- ior is as if the message queue remains empty, and no notification will be sent. RETURN VALUES
Upon successful completion, the value 0 is returned; otherwise the value -1 is returned and the global variable errno is set to indicate the error. ERRORS
The mq_notify() system call will fail if: [EBADF] The mqdes argument is not a valid message queue descriptor. [EBUSY] Process is already registered for notification by the message queue. SEE ALSO

The mq_notify() system call conforms to IEEE Std 1003.1-2004 (``POSIX.1''). HISTORY
Support for POSIX message queues first appeared in FreeBSD 7.0. COPYRIGHT

NAME
mq_notify - Attaches a request for asynchronous signal notification to a message queue (P1003.1b) LIBRARY
Realtime Library (librt.so, librt.a) SYNOPSIS
#include <mqueue.h> int mq_notify ( mqd_t mqdes, const struct sigevent *notification); PARAMETERS
mqdes Specifies a message queue descriptor. *notification Specifies a signal to be sent when the specified queue accepts a message. If the notification argument is NULL, and the process has previously attached a notification request to the message queue with this mqdes argument, the notification request is detached and the queue is available for another process to attach a notification request. DESCRIPTION
The mq_notify function attaches a request for asynchronous signal notification to a message queue for the calling process. Following a call to this function, the specified signal is sent to the calling process when the queue transitions from empty to non-empty. Two or more processes cannot attach notification requests to the same queue at the same time. If a process has attached a notification request and any process is blocked in the execution of the mq_receive function waiting to receive a message when a message arrives at the queue, then the appropriate mq_receive function is completed and the notification remains pending. When the notification has been sent, the registration is canceled. In effect, it is a one-shot notification and must be re-registered if required. Note that the POSIX IPC functions are not reentrant with respect to signals. For example, if your application were to use a signal to notify it that a queue has become non-empty and then attempt to call mq_receive from the signal handler, the signal handler must reside in a thread other than the tread that called mq_send. Otherwise, a deadlock on internal locks would occur. RETURN VALUES
On successful completion, the function returns the value 0 (zero); otherwise, the function returns the value -1 and sets errno to indicate the error. ERRORS
The mq_notify function fails under the following conditions: [EBADF] The mqdes argument is not a valid message queue descriptor. [EBUSY] A process has already attached to this message queue for asynchronous notification, or the calling process attempted to can- cel a request that was attached by another process. [EINVAL] The requested signo is invalid, or the sigev_notify field of the notification structure does not equal SIGEV_SIGNAL. RELATED INFORMATION
